Greater Manchester leaders back £69.5m plans for new rail stations, extra Metrolink stops and better bus routes - www.manchestereveningnews.co.uk - Manchester
manchestereveningnews.co.uk
29.01.2021 / 18:32

Greater Manchester leaders back £69.5m plans for new rail stations, extra Metrolink stops and better bus routes

direct to your inboxGreater Manchester leaders have agreed to spend more than £69m on developing a ‘world class’ public transport system in the city-region. The combined authority will progress plans for a long-awaited £15m railway station in Golborne, extra Metrolink stops, and improved bus services on northern and eastern routes.

‘The Real Housewives Of New York’ Shut Down After Cast Member’s Covid-19 Case - deadline.com - New York - New York - New Jersey
deadline.com
15.01.2021 / 04:51

‘The Real Housewives Of New York’ Shut Down After Cast Member’s Covid-19 Case

Last summer, NY cast member Ramona Singer said she had tested positive. In other spinoffs, positive cases were reported by Shannon Beador and Emily Simpson of the Real Housewives of Orange County, by Kyle RIchards, Kathy Hilton and Dorit Kemsley of Real Housewives of Beverly Hills, by Jennifer Aydin of Real Housewives of New Jersey, and by D’Andra Simmons of Real Housewives of Dallas.
